In Wuhan, having breakfast has a special name: "guo zao." From the iconic hot dry noodles that come coated in sesame paste to sizzling dumplings and "dou pi" – crepes made with tofu skin, minced meat, and glutinous rice – early risers are spoiled for choice in Wuhan.
